Comprehensive Standard for Microphone Calibration and Measurement
The BS EN 61094-5:2016 is a crucial standard for the metrology and measurement of physical phenomena, specifically in the field of acoustics. This standard provides detailed guidelines and requirements for the calibration and measurement of microphones, ensuring accurate and reliable acoustic measurements across a wide range of applications.Ensure Accurate, Reliable Acoustic Measurements
